Legalizing Gay Marriage in Australia

Australia is the closest it’s ever been to legalizing gay marriage. 61% of Australians voted in favor of legalizing gay marriage. 79.5% of the country as a whole participated in voting for the legalization.

They have sent it to the lawmakers and they are currently debating on what to do about the matter. One of their biggest concerns is religious beliefs of the country as a whole.

Majority of Australians are ready for this change to become legal.
